Why Continuous Learning is Essential for Healthcare Professionals

The healthcare industry is constantly evolving, with new medical advancements, technologies, and treatment methods emerging regularly. For healthcare professionals, staying up to date through continuous learning is not just a career advantage—it’s a necessity. Ongoing education ensures high-quality patient care, enhances professional skills, and helps maintain compliance with industry regulations.
Explore why continuous learning is essential for healthcare professionals and how it can benefit both individuals and the healthcare system as a whole.
1. Keeping Up with Medical Advancements
Medical science is constantly evolving, with new research leading to improved treatments and better patient outcomes. Continuous education helps healthcare professionals:
Stay updated on the latest medical procedures and technologies.
Understand new drugs and treatment protocols.
Implement evidence-based practices in patient care.
2. Enhancing Patient Care and Safety
Patients expect the best possible care, and outdated knowledge can lead to errors. Continuous learning ensures that healthcare professionals:
Follow the latest best practices for diagnosis and treatment.
Improve patient safety by reducing medical errors.
Provide high-quality, patient-centered care.
3. Meeting Regulatory and Certification Requirements
Many healthcare professionals must meet licensing and certification requirements that mandate ongoing education. Continuous learning helps professionals:
Maintain their certifications and licenses.
Comply with legal and ethical healthcare standards.
Stay aligned with government and healthcare policies.
4. Advancing Career Growth and Opportunities
Learning new skills can open doors to better career opportunities, including promotions and specialization. Benefits of continuous learning include:
Expanding career options in specialized fields such as critical care, palliative care, and mental health.
Gaining leadership skills for managerial roles.
Increasing earning potential through advanced certifications.
5. Adapting to Emerging Healthcare Technologies
Technology plays a significant role in modern healthcare, from electronic health records (EHRs) to artificial intelligence (AI) in diagnostics. Continuous learning ensures that professionals:
Understand and effectively use new medical equipment and software.
Stay competitive in a rapidly changing healthcare landscape.
Improve efficiency in patient care through technological advancements.
6. Boosting Professional Confidence and Competence
Confidence in one’s skills directly impacts job performance. Ongoing education helps healthcare workers:
Feel more competent in handling complex medical situations.
Improve communication skills with patients and colleagues.
Enhance problem-solving and decision-making abilities.
7. Encouraging Lifelong Learning and Professional Development
Healthcare is a lifelong journey of learning. Professionals who embrace continuous education:
Stay motivated and engaged in their work.
Develop a habit of critical thinking and problem-solving.
Build strong networks by engaging in professional training programs and conferences.
How to Incorporate Continuous Learning into Your Healthcare Career
There are many ways healthcare professionals can continue their education:
Online Courses & Webinars – Platforms like Care Learning, Coursera, and Udemy offer healthcare-specific training.
Workshops & Seminars – Attending hands-on training sessions improves practical skills.
Certifications & Advanced Degrees – Pursuing higher education opens new career opportunities.
Professional Networking – Engaging in healthcare communities and discussions fosters learning.
Continuous learning is the foundation of a successful and rewarding healthcare career. By staying updated, healthcare professionals can provide the best possible patient care, grow in their careers, and contribute to an ever-evolving industry.

What is the difference between physiotherapy and Neurotherapy?
In the realm of healthcare, both physiotherapy and neurotherapy play crucial roles in improving patients' well-being and restoring functionality. However, despite some similarities, these two disciplines differ significantly in their approaches and focus areas.
Physiotherapy:
Physiotherapy, also known as physical therapy, encompasses a broad spectrum of treatments aimed at enhancing mobility, function, and quality of life. It addresses musculoskeletal and neurological conditions through exercise, manual therapy, and other modalities. Here are some key aspects of physiotherapy:
Musculoskeletal Focus: Physiotherapy primarily deals with conditions affecting muscles, bones, joints, and soft tissues. Common issues include sprains, strains, fractures, arthritis, and post-surgical rehabilitation.
Range of Techniques: Physiotherapists employ a diverse range of techniques, including exercises, stretches, massages, ultrasound therapy, electrical stimulation, and heat/cold therapy. These interventions are tailored to address specific patient needs and goals.
Functional Rehabilitation: The ultimate goal of physiotherapy is to restore optimal function and mobility. Therapists work closely with patients to improve strength, flexibility, balance, and coordination, enabling them to perform daily activities with greater ease.
How does Physiotherapy work?
Assessment and Evaluation: The process begins with a thorough assessment by a qualified physiotherapist. This assessment involves gathering information about the patient's medical history, current symptoms, mobility limitations, and functional goals. Physical examinations, including tests of strength, flexibility, balance, and range of motion, are also conducted to identify areas of concern.
Individualized Treatment Plan: Based on the assessment findings, the physiotherapist develops a customized treatment plan tailored to the patient's specific needs and goals. This plan may include a combination of therapeutic exercises, manual therapy techniques, modalities, and education on self-management strategies.
Therapeutic Exercises: Exercise therapy is a cornerstone of physiotherapy. Patients are guided through a series of exercises designed to improve strength, flexibility, endurance, balance, and coordination. These exercises are selected to target specific muscle groups or movement patterns related to the patient's condition.
Neurotherapy:
Neurotherapy, on the other hand, focuses specifically on conditions affecting the nervous system, including the brain, spinal cord, and peripheral nerves. It involves targeted interventions aimed at improving neurological function and managing symptoms related to neurological disorders. Here are some key aspects of neurotherapy:
Neurological Disorders: Neurotherapy is designed to address a wide range of neurological conditions, such as stroke, traumatic brain injury, spinal cord injury, multiple sclerosis, Parkinson's disease, and neuropathy.
Specialized Techniques: Neurotherapists utilize specialized techniques tailored to stimulate neural pathways, enhance neuroplasticity, and promote neuroregeneration. These may include neurofeedback, cognitive rehabilitation, sensory integration therapy, and neuromuscular re-education.
Functional Restoration: Similar to physiotherapy, neurotherapy aims to restore function and improve quality of life. However, it places particular emphasis on optimizing neurological function, facilitating recovery of lost abilities, and maximizing independence in daily activities.
How does neurotherapy use?
Assessment and Evaluation: The process typically begins with a comprehensive assessment conducted by a qualified neurotherapist. This assessment may include gathering information about the patient's medical history, symptoms, cognitive functioning, and behavioral patterns. Additionally, neuroimaging techniques such as EEG (electroencephalography) may be used to measure brainwave activity and identify any aberrant patterns associated with the patient's condition.
Identification of Treatment Targets: Based on the assessment findings, specific treatment targets are identified. These targets may vary depending on the patient's symptoms and underlying neurological condition. Common treatment goals include improving attention, concentration, memory, mood regulation, and cognitive function.
Neurofeedback Sessions: Neurotherapy primarily involves neurofeedback sessions, during which the patient is connected to a neurofeedback system that monitors brainwave activity in real time. Typically, sensors are placed on the scalp to measure electrical signals produced by the brain. These signals are then processed and displayed on a computer screen as visual or auditory feedback.
Long-Term Maintenance and Follow-Up: After completing a course of neurotherapy, patients may benefit from periodic maintenance sessions to sustain treatment gains and address any relapse or new symptoms that arise over time. Follow-up assessments and monitoring help track progress and adjust treatment as needed to support ongoing well-being.
Key Differences:
While both physiotherapy and neurotherapy share the overarching goal of improving patients' health and function, they differ in their scope and focus areas. Physiotherapy primarily addresses musculoskeletal conditions and rehabilitation, whereas neurotherapy specializes in neurological disorders and interventions targeted at the nervous system.
In summary, physiotherapy and neurotherapy are complementary disciplines within the field of rehabilitation, each offering valuable expertise in distinct areas of healthcare. By understanding the differences between these two modalities, individuals can make informed decisions about their treatment options and access the most appropriate care for their needs.

How Advanced Clinical Practitioners Can Lead in Telemedicine and Digital Healthcare

The rise of telemedicine and digital healthcare is transforming the way healthcare services are delivered. As healthcare systems continue to embrace technology, Advanced Clinical Practitioners (ACPs) are well-positioned to take a leading role in this evolving landscape. With their expertise in diagnosis, treatment, and patient care, ACPs can bridge the gap between traditional healthcare and digital innovations.
Explore how ACPs can leverage telemedicine and digital tools to improve patient outcomes, expand healthcare access, and enhance their own career prospects.
1. The Expanding Role of Advanced Clinical Practitioners in Telemedicine
ACPs bring a high level of clinical expertise and autonomy to patient care. Their ability to assess, diagnose, and treat patients makes them ideal candidates for telemedicine roles. With the shift toward virtual healthcare, ACPs can:
Conduct remote patient consultations
Provide ongoing management for chronic conditions
Offer digital follow-ups and patient education
Support urgent care and triage services via telehealth platforms
By integrating telemedicine into their practice, ACPs can reduce patient waiting times, enhance accessibility, and streamline healthcare delivery.
2. Using Digital Tools to Improve Patient Care
Technology plays a crucial role in enhancing patient outcomes. ACPs can lead the way by utilizing digital tools such as:
Electronic Health Records (EHRs) – Ensuring seamless patient information sharing for coordinated care.
Remote Monitoring Devices – Tracking patient vitals and symptoms in real-time, allowing for proactive intervention.
AI-Powered Diagnostic Tools – Assisting with early disease detection and personalized treatment plans.
Mobile Health Apps – Empowering patients to manage their own health through guided interventions and virtual consultations.
By integrating these technologies, ACPs can provide more efficient, data-driven, and patient-centered care.
3. Enhancing Healthcare Access with Telemedicine
One of the biggest advantages of telemedicine is expanding healthcare access to underserved populations. ACPs can play a critical role in:
Providing care to rural and remote communities
Reducing the burden on hospital emergency departments
Supporting home-based care for elderly and disabled patients
Offering mental health services through virtual therapy sessions
By leveraging telehealth, ACPs can increase accessibility while maintaining high-quality patient care.
4. Leadership and Training in Digital Healthcare
As telemedicine becomes more mainstream, ACPs can take leadership roles in training and mentoring healthcare teams on best practices for digital healthcare. Key areas where ACPs can lead include:
Educating colleagues on telehealth protocols and patient engagement techniques
Developing digital healthcare policies and compliance standards
Advocating for the integration of telemedicine in healthcare systems
By taking the initiative, ACPs can shape the future of digital healthcare and drive improvements in virtual patient care.
5. Overcoming Challenges in Telemedicine
While telemedicine offers many benefits, there are also challenges that ACPs need to navigate, including:
Ensuring patient data security and confidentiality
Managing digital literacy gaps among patients and providers
Navigating licensing and regulatory requirements for virtual consultations
Maintaining patient-provider rapport in virtual settings
With proper training and adaptation, ACPs can overcome these challenges and optimize telehealth services for improved patient care.
Advanced Clinical Practitioners are uniquely positioned to lead in telemedicine and digital healthcare. By embracing technology, they can enhance patient care, expand healthcare access, and take on leadership roles in the digital transformation of healthcare. As telemedicine continues to evolve, ACPs who integrate digital tools into their practice will be at the forefront of a more efficient, accessible, and patient-centered healthcare system.
